Every time I'm roping up at the base of exasperator I definitely think twice about safety. Those that don't know some one got dropped there are more likely to repeat past mistakes.

People need to realize that climbing IS a dangerous sport and mistakes are way too costly. It can happen to you.

Condolences to the friends and family. A plaque is a good memorial and may serve to prevent similar problems in the future.
